An average daddy day nowadays roughly looks as follows:
7:00: Tobias wakes up, he gets a bottle
9:00: Tobias is done with his bottle an plays in his play pen
10:00: Tobias gets tired and/or had done a #2 so he gets cleaned and dressed
11:00: Tobias slept for a while and is now waking up, we play for a while
12:00: Tobias is hungry, he gets rice serial mixed with some formula
13:00: We go into town to do some shopping, groceries, or just walking around (most of the time Tobias sleeps while we walk
15:00: We get back home and play
16:00: Tobias gets hungry again, he gets some fruit
17:30: Tobias' dinner time, that means solid food nowadays (see previous post)
18:00: Mommy comes home, Tobias plays with her while I post some pictures to the blog :-)
19:30: Bed time ritual starts: 4 B's: Bath, Book, Bottle, Bed
By 20:30 Tobias is sound asleep.
